The Scope of the Refurbishment Program
Arriva Rail North’s (ARN) £100 million investment involved the comprehensive refurbishment of 268 trains. This wasn’t a simple cosmetic upgrade; the project encompassed a wide range of improvements designed to enhance both passenger comfort and operational efficiency. The work, carried out at eight train maintenance depots across the UK, required the expertise of specialists from approximately 20 different fields. This highlights the complexity of modern rolling stock (trains) and the multidisciplinary nature of the undertaking. The improvements included replacing flooring, repainting exteriors, and overhauling onboard systems and engines to improve reliability. Crucially, passenger-focused amenities were upgraded, such as installing new seating, at-seat power outlets, fully accessible toilets with baby-changing facilities, and free Wi-Fi. The addition of customer information screens and sustainable lighting further enhanced the passenger experience, while CCTV systems improved security.
Economic Impact and Job Creation
Beyond the direct benefits to passengers, the modernization program generated significant positive economic impacts. The project created 105 new jobs, spanning diverse roles including electricians, bodywork engineers, computer programmers, and commercial painters. This demonstrates the substantial employment opportunities associated with large-scale railway infrastructure projects. Furthermore, ARN contracted Chrysalis Rail, a Leeds-based company, to assist with the upgrade. This subcontracting created further employment and investment opportunities within the local community and reinforced the importance of supporting local businesses within the UK railway industry. Chrysalis Rail’s involvement highlighted the positive impact on smaller companies, illustrating how major modernization projects can stimulate economic activity throughout the supply chain. The investment in colleague training and apprenticeships by Chrysalis Rail further underscores the commitment to skill development and the creation of a sustainable workforce.
